These days, the very popular blood sugar diet. It's also something I'm concerned about... haha Does blood sugar diet really work? In conclusion, blood sugar dieting is highly effective for weight loss and the prevention and alleviation of diabetes. The key to a blood sugar diet is maintaining a diet that does not cause a rapid increase in blood sugar. Excessive intake of high-glycemic foods such as sugar or carbohydrates can lead to a sudden rise in blood sugar, known as a 'blood sugar spike,' so it is important to consume carbohydrates with a low glycemic index (GI) to prevent this. Refined carbohydrates such as white rice, noodles, and bread with high glycemic index are quickly digested, causing a rapid increase in blood sugar levels and potentially triggering excessive insulin secretion. On the other hand, multigrain rice, bread made from whole grains, and whole wheat pasta are digested more slowly, gradually raising blood sugar levels and aiding in the efficient use of insulin. Additionally, foods with low glycemic index such as oats, burdock root, peas, broccoli, and spinach are also beneficial choices for blood sugar management and dieting. Changing the order of meals also plays an important role in preventing blood sugar spikes. By consuming fiber-rich vegetables first, followed by protein, and finally carbohydrates, you can control the rate of blood sugar increase. This method can prevent blood sugar spikes even when eating the same food and ultimately have a positive effect on weight loss. Additionally, limiting simple sugar intake is an important factor in a blood sugar diet. Foods high in simple sugars such as cola, ice cream, and snacks have low nutritional value and cause rapid increases in blood sugar, making it easy to store as body fat. These foods are major culprits that increase the risk of obesity and diabetes and should be thoroughly avoided. Regular eating habits are also an important part of a blood sugar diet. Eating at consistent times allows the body to consume energy regularly and prevents fat accumulation. Irregular eating habits cause the body to store fat in preparation for emergencies and can increase pancreatic fatigue. Therefore, it is important to maintain regular meal times and routines.

Unsweetened peanut butter is made solely from peanuts without sugar or other additives. Peanuts have a low glycemic index (GI) of 14. In other words, unsweetened peanut butter causes a relatively slow increase in blood sugar compared to regular peanut butter or other fruit jams, making it suitable for dieting. This is to prevent a rapid increase in blood sugar levels and reduce insulin resistance. Peanuts are rich in protein and fat. Unsweetened peanut butter is similar, providing a long-lasting sense of fullness. Moreover, about 75% of the fats in peanut butter are unsaturated fatty acids, which are less likely to accumulate in the body and are more likely to be lost through stool, helping with weight loss. Peanut butter pairs well with apples in terms of nutrition. Apples and peanut butter have different rich nutrients. ✔️Apples are rich in carbohydrates, vitamin C, and potassium. ✔️ Peanut butter is rich in protein, unsaturated fatty acids, niacin, vitamin E, and magnesium. Therefore, eating them together fills the nutritional gaps in the apple that peanut butter lacks, and conversely, the peanut butter compensates for the nutrients missing in the apple, balancing the nutrition. It fits well. ◇Aesabi Aesabi is short for Apple Cider Vinegar, which refers to fermented apple vinegar. Fermented apple vinegar helps prevent diabetes by suppressing blood sugar spikes. In fact, a research team from Aspahan Medical College in Iran conducted a study with 110 diabetes patients, where some participants consumed about 200mL of water and 15mL of apple vinegar for three months. The results showed that their blood sugar and glycated hemoglobin levels (average blood sugar over the past 2-3 months) were lower than those who did not consume it. However, caution should be exercised when drinking apple cider vinegar straight. Its strong acidity can cause damage to the esophagus or stomach. Diluting about 15-30 mL in water or carbonated water and drinking it is appropriate. Also, do not brush your teeth immediately after consuming apple cider vinegar. Brushing with alkaline apple cider vinegar residue on the teeth can wear down the enamel that protects the dentin. It is recommended to wait at least 30 minutes after consuming apple cider vinegar before brushing your teeth.

Director Choi Woo-hyuk Hello, this is Director Choi Woo-hyuk. High blood sugar refers to an abnormally high level of glucose in the blood, and if not properly managed, it can develop into an acute complication that threatens life. When it comes to hyperglycemic complications, the commonly used term is "hyperglycemic shock," but this is not a medical term. In reality, the types of acute hyperglycemic complications are classified as di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A) and hyperosmolar hyperglycemic syndrome (HHS). In this article, I will explain the symptoms, causes, diagnostic criteria, treatment methods, and prevention strategies for hyperglycemia, including hyperglycemic shock and other acute hyperglycemic complications. What is high blood sugar? High blood sugar is a condition where the glucose level in the blood becomes abnormally high, primarily occurring in diabetic patients. In healthy individuals, insulin regulates blood sugar, but in diabetics or people with impaired insulin function, high blood sugar is more likely to occur. If these high blood sugar levels are not managed, they can lead to hyperglycemic complications. Hyperglycemic complications mostly occur in people who have been diagnosed with diabetes or have not yet been diagnosed, but whose blood sugar levels already fall within the diagnostic criteria for diabetes. In normal individuals, it is difficult for blood sugar to become so high as to cause hyperglycemic complications. Symptoms and progression stages of hyperglycemia In the early stages of hyperglycemia, symptoms may be mild, but as blood sugar levels rise, symptoms such as dry mouth, frequent urination, fatigue, and blurred vision appear. If blood sugar levels increase rapidly, hyperglycemic acute complications may occur. Acute hyperglycemic complications are classified into di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A) and hyperosmolar hyperglycemic syndrome (HHS). When acute hyperglycemic complications occur, they cause electrolyte imbalances, leading to symptoms such as dizziness, ab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, and even altered consciousness or loss of consciousness. The term "hyperglycemic shock" is commonly used to describe symptoms such as coma and unconsciousness, but it is not a medical term, and the definition of shock is different from coma and unconsciousness, making it an incorrect concept. The correct term to describe conditions caused by a sudden increase in blood sugar levels in the body is "hyperglycemic acute complication." Causes of high blood sugar The causes of high blood sugar generally include eating more than usual, frequently consuming snacks high in carbohydrates, decreased physical activity, and stress, and these factors affect both healthy individuals and diabetics. In this case, it can also occur if diabetic patients do not properly take their oral hypoglycemic agents or insulin injections. In rare cases, when stress situations such as infection or trauma occur in individuals with pre-existing conditions, stress hormones like cortisol in the body may increase, leading to elevated blood sugar levels. Criteria for judging high blood sugar levels First, the definition of hyperglycemia includes all cases where blood sugar levels are higher than normal blood sugar levels. Fasting blood sugar between 70 and 99 mg/dL, and blood sugar less than or equal to 139 mg/dL two hours after a meal are considered normal ranges. A fasting blood sugar of 126 mg/dL or higher, or blood sugar of 200 mg/dL or higher two hours after a meal, meet the diagnostic criteria for diabetes. Symptoms of acute hyperglycemic complications When blood sugar levels exceed a certain threshold, the risk of life-threatening hyperglycemic acute complications increases. Hyperglycemic acute complications vary in diagnostic criteria and pathophysiology depending on the type. A table summarizing the differences between the two types of hyperglycemic acute complications, DKA and HHS, is provided for your reference. Differences between DKA and HHS Characteristics Di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A) Hyperosmolar Hyperglycemic Syndrome (HHS) Main patient groups Type 1 diabetes patient Type 2 diabetes mellitus patient Cause of onset Increased fat breakdown and ketone accumulation due to insulin deficiency Insulin action remains partially present, but severe hyperglycemia and dehydration lead to increased osmotic pressure. Blood sugar level standards Exceeds 200 mg/dL Exceeds 600 mg/dL Rate of onset Rapid progress (several hours to several days) Gradual progress (several days to several weeks) Main symptoms Abdominal pain, vomiting, severe thirst, rapid and deep breathing, decreased consciousness, etc. Severe thirst, increased urination, confusion, decreased consciousness, etc. Prevention methods Insulin maintenance Fluid intake, insulin or medication administration For diabetic patients, especially those at high risk of complications, it is important to regularly monitor blood glucose levels from the outset. Hyperglycemic acute complications are serious emergency situations that can occur in diabetic patients, requiring prompt and appropriate response. High blood sugar treatment Treatment for high blood sugar varies depending on severity. In mild cases, increasing fluid intake, adjusting carbohydrate consumption, and engaging in light exercise can help lower blood sugar levels. In patients with diabetes, insulin or other prescribed medications are generally adjusted under the guidance of a physician. Immediate medical intervention, including intravenous fluid therapy, insulin therapy, and electrolyte supplementation, is necessary to treat serious complications such as hyperosmolar hyperglycemic state (HHS) or diabetic ketoacidosis (DKA). Prevention of high blood sugar To prevent high blood sugar, it is essential to regulate lifestyle habits and regularly check blood sugar levels. Maintaining a low-carbohydrate diet, increasing muscle mass through exercise to improve insulin resistance, and managing stress are helpful measures. Diabetic patients should regularly monitor their blood sugar levels and adjust oral hypoglycemic agents or insulin as needed to prevent prolonged hyperglycemia. High blood sugar is a condition that can lead to serious complications, including diabetic ketoacidosis, if left untreated. Pay attention to early symptoms of high blood sugar, initiate early treatment, and maintain normal blood sugar levels through regular blood sugar monitoring and lifestyle improvements to preserve a healthy life. “I eat the same as before, but why do I gain more weight?” Postmenopausal weight gain is not simply a body shape issue. Issues directly related to metabolic changes and health risks It is important to understand that. In particular, increased visceral fat and decreased metabolic rate can be linked to the risk of hyperlipidemia, hypertension, and diabetes, so it is necessary to approach it from a long-term management perspective. 1. Why do we gain weight more easily during menopause? Menopausal weight gain Decreased female hormones + decreased basal metabolic rate It is a structural change that works simultaneously. Even if you maintain the same amount of food during this period, It is characterized by easy weight gain due to the body's reduced energy use. 2. The principle of body shape changing around the abdomen 2.1 Decrease in female hormones and changes in fat distribution As female hormones decrease, the location of fat accumulation tends to change. Reduction of hip and thigh fat Increased abdominal and flank fat Tendency to increase visceral fat This change is not a simple change in body shape. It may also be linked to an increased risk of adult diseases. Also, more than BMI Waist circumference better reflects visceral fat status It is an indicator of doing so. 2.2 Decreased basal metabolic rate and muscle mass problems During menopause, the amount of energy your body needs decreases. Decreased muscle mass → decreased basal metabolic rate Increased body fat percentage → decreased energy consumption Weight gain while maintaining the same food intake Especially if you have little exercise experience and low muscle mass. Weight gain may occur more quickly. 3. A Realistic Approach to Menopause Diet (Key Methods) 3.1 Diet: “Portion control + blood sugar management” Weight management during menopause is based on diet control. Realistic criteria: Adjust to reduce your usual intake Minimize white rice, white bread, and sugary drinks Maintain protein intake Gradually reduce sugar intake, such as from mixed coffee and syrup. Rather than expecting to lose weight through exercise alone, Controlling intake is a priority is described as: 3.2 Exercise: “Increasing daily activity” rather than excessive exercise High-intensity exercise from the beginning can be difficult to sustain. Recommended approach: Increased daily activity levels, such as walking Use public transportation, use stairs Gradual increase in exercise after physical recovery Make it a habit to walk for more than 30 minutes Especially during menopause, consider joint pain and fatigue. Step-by-step exercise focused on improving physical strength This is appropriate. 4. Misconceptions to be aware of (Caution) It's difficult to lose weight through exercise alone. Rapid exercise can lead to pain and compensatory eating. Weight gain is difficult to view solely as a cosmetic issue. Increased visceral fat is linked to a higher risk of metabolic disease. Also, it is not based on hunger It is important to change your perception and adjust your intake based on what your body needs. 5. Why You Should Take a Long-Term View (Summary) Menopausal weight management is more than just short-term weight loss. Ambassadorial Health Management Perspective This is the key. Weight gain → Increased risk of hyperlipidemia and hypertension Increased waist circumference → Visceral fat indicator It is recommended to try to improve your diet and lifestyle habits for about 3 months. Rather than an extreme diet A way to gradually adjust your lifestyle habits It is presented as a more realistic approach to ongoing management.
